Who is MSFAA?
 
 
   Who is MSFAA?
     
 

The Michigan Student Financial Aid Association (MSFAA), founded in 1967, is a state organization that brings together postsecondary schools and other public and private organizations involved with providing financial aid for students. The Executive Board, which consists of seven members and five sector representatives, govern the organization within the guidelines set forth in the bylaws. Working together, committees carry out the tasks mandated by the Executive Board during the course of the year.

 
     
     
   MSFAA Mission Statement
     
  The mission of the Association is to enhance student financial aid awareness, to promote student access to postsecondary education and to provide professional development opportunities for its members.
